I am confused what shall I do my speech on for the English speaking and listening gcse?

English
2 answers:
expeople1 [14]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

I did my speech about the Misuse of Drugs and Alcohol, u can write about the effects of it as well as giving statistics and own opinions with facts etc. Also use sophisticated language.

However for the speech they said you can talk about anything for e.g a book that you like or a holiday you went to etc. as long as it's good and lasts 5min.
